There have been several reviews of polygraph accuracy. They suggest that polygraphs are accurate between 80% and 90% of the time. This means polygraphs are far from foolproof, but better than the ...

Polygraph measurements—derived from changes in blood pressure, breathing depth, and skin conductivity of an electric current—have never been proved to be reliable …Advocates agree that a polygraph exam is 80% to 90% accurate. Detractors, on the other hand, say polygraphy’s accuracy is more around 70% only. The point? A lie detector test is not 100% accurate. Research indicates that there's no reliable physiological responses present when a person is lying. The National Academy of Sciences issued a report in 2003 deeming the polygraph test to be biased, unreliable, and unscientific. Most researchers in the science community consider the polygraph test to be pseudo-scientific, and it's been found to ... In short: “lie detector” might not be the best nickname for the polygraph. The American Polygraph Association says that its trained examiners can get an accuracy rate of more than 90%. Its website claims that thousands of its members give polygraph tests around …Whereas the American Polygraph Association claims accuracy rates of over 90 percent, leading critics, such as David Lykken 1 put the polygraph accuracy rate at around 65 percent that is only ...Estimates of the accuracy of one popular form of the polygraph test, the Comparison Question Test, put it at 85% for guilty individuals and 60% for innocent individuals. “That 40% of honest examinees appear deceptive provides exceedingly poor protection for innocent suspects,” suggests Lilienfeld (p. 120). Because of their limited … In sum, most polygraph machines are able to accurately measure physiological responses that are indicators of stress and anxiety, but polygraph tests should not be used to determine whether someone is lying or not because that's not what the machine is measuring.
